Lg Oled65c2pua will not turn on
Could not stand seeing such a newer tv thrown away, so decided to take a stab at it. No picture, no sound ,no indication of standby and no relay click when pressing power button. Voltages on cable that goes from PS to main seem correct. 20v, 12v, and 3.35 on pin for pwr-on. No 12v on cable from PS to top of tcon board. No 22v on cable from PS to side of tcon board.
Ordered repair kit that included all three boards. Installed all three and no change to indications except I now get optical light. Still no standby light and no relay click. I did get 3.39v on DRV-ON on cable PS-main, which I did not have before. I also got 12v on cable PS-tcon (top), which I did not have before. I also get .74v on (not 22v) on cable PS-tcon (side), which I did not have before.
Any thoughts would be appreciated.
Installed old main back and lost 12v to Tcon, optical light, and 22v cable to Tcon went to 0v. Old main definitely looks bad. Put new main back and got 12v to Tcon,optical light back. Also .74v on 22v line to Tcon. .74v remains with cables disconnected Tcon- main.
Put old Tcon back in with no change. Put new one back in. Then put old PS back in and when I plugged it in I heard a relay click followed by screen coming up. Looks like original main was bad and then the kit PS was bad. Now we have picture and sound but tv comes up when plugging in (without pressing power on) and you can’t turn off with switch or remote. Well a tech said that it sounded like it was in factory mode. He said I had to get an older lg remote without voice to get into the menu. As I was going through spare remotes, the tv went off. Took apart and voltages missing. Sent kit back for replacement.

Got replacement kit and installed. Left power switch/ infrared cable unplugged from main board. When plugged in picture came up and instructed that select switch on remote be pressed. Again , tv came up without power switch/infrared connected.
Unplugged tv and plugged cable back into main. When power plugged in picture came up with same instruction to press select on remote. I did with no effect except it did affect my security system that is in the same room. Tried unlinking and relinking remote with no help. Will get another lg remote tomorrow.

Checked my remote on daughter’s tv and worked fine. Tried her remote on my tv with no response. As much as I hate to think it, I think it is another bad main board. Display and sound seems fine, just no control with remote or switch. That and the tv coming up when just plugging in. When I first installed this second kit, I left the button/infrared disconnected in case a problem with that assembly was causing main board malfunction. There was no difference.
